3. Sugar cravings

If you’re among the vast majority of Americans who have a serious sweet tooth, you’re in good company.  The nature of food addiction, more specifically, sugar addition, has been studied and shown to be extremely common and as intense as addictions to opiates like cocaine and heroin. Part of the reason it’s so hard to kick the habit is that over time, our brains actually become addicted to the natural opioids that are triggered by sugar consumption. Like with drugs, a diet loaded with sugar can generate excessive reward signals in the brain which can override self-control and lead to addiction. In fact, researchers at Princeton University report that sugar-loving mice demonstrate all three criteria of addiction: increased intake, withdrawal, and cravings that lead to relapse. Yowza.
